Transaction dfd55abae0af8a757918b52e4c20bb754fde29da73c9a277abe4d427e307c506
1 Input
1 Output
-
dfd55abae0af8a757918b52e4c20bb754fde29da73c9a277abe4d427e307c506:0
- value
- 53670
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dfb3aaf98f2bf72d0bfef2bb47b4fd7504b1dee
- address
- bc1q0han4tuc72lh959lau4mg7606agyk80ws269sp